  • Patent number: 6855205
    Abstract: An apparatus for placing particles onto a substrate, methods for using the apparatus to deposit particles on a substrate and substrates prepared using the apparatus are disclosed. The apparatus includes a rotary screen, a blade disposed for directing and urging the particles through the screen, and a sheet mounted in a position to receive the particles from a feeder and deliver the particles to the rotary screen substantially across the blade. The apparatus can include a frame on which a rotary screen is rotatably mounted and a feed system disposed within and extending substantially along the length of the screen for distributing the particles. The apparatus can optionally include a vacuum means, an anti-static means and/or collection pans for handling stray particles. The screen can include a series of openings in the form of a pattern, and can be used to place particles in a pattern in register with a design or pattern on a substrate as the substrate passes under the openings in the screen.

  • Patent number: 4801100
    Abstract: A rotary batch-type grinding mill for processing powder is provided with an improved system for discharging material under seal from the atmosphere. The discharge system comprises a sealable collection chute having a banana-like configuration secured on the mill shell at an outlet port in the shell and extending substantially parallel to the circumference of the shell, a grate which prevents discharge of the grinding media from the mill during unloading of material from the mill and an elastomeric faced sealing plate which covers the grate during operation of the mill. The sealing plate is operated from outside the sealed system so that discharge from the mill can be effected without breaking the seal and the sealing plate is so disposed that in the open position it does not interfere with the flow of powder out of the mill.

  • Patent number: 4679736
    Abstract: A rotary mill is provided with an improved loading means for charging material to the mill. The loading means is particularly adaptable for charging a batch-type rotary mill in a protective environment when, as part of a loading assembly of this invention, it is provided with removable plug and loading conduit members which can be interchanged without exposing the mill or charge material to air during the loading of the mill.

  • Patent number: 4653335
    Abstract: A system for obtaining a sample of particulate material being processed under seal from the air in a batch-type rotary grinding mill which permits sampling of material being processed without disturbing the seal. The system is comprised of a sampling member and a plug member which can be interchanged under seal while maintaining the seal in the mill.

  • Patent number: 4603814
    Abstract: A batch-type rotary grinding mill operable under seal to the atmosphere is provided with a discharge system which permits discharge of material from the mill under seal and without disturbing the seal in the mill. The discharge system comprises at least one discharge chute which is sealably secured to the shell wall, spiraling adjacent to the shell and traversing the shell wall from one end to the other. The material is discharged from the discharge chute via a hollow trunnion which, preferably, contains a conveyor to aid in passing the material out of the mill into an environmentally protected device.
